I've switched back and forth so many times I've lost count. Since I installed Office 2008, I went back to try Entourage again, and I'm liking it so far. It does all the same things as Mail/iCal/Address Book, etc, but all from one place, and there's something to be said for that.

I also like the Project Center because I do a lot of different things in my job, and it's nice to be able to keep track of what meeting is for what project and which contacts are on this grant, but not the other grant, and so forth.

Don't dismiss it just because it's a Microsoft program
 
I would very much like to use Entourage but I won't because of the following reasons:
  • Entourage uses a single Database file which isn't compatible to Time Machine
  • Contacts View is inferior to Addressbook
  • Syncing with .Mac is problematic to say the least. If you aren't carefull you end up with many many duplicates...
  • Doesn't directly sync with my iPhone - only indirectly through .Mac and iSync.
  • Definitively slower than Mail.app on my Mac Pro...
